Original Description
Oskar Bluemner’s Industrial Landscape is a striking modernist depiction of early 20th-century urban expansion, radiating a bold yet moody energy. Painted in 1917, this work exemplifies Bluemner’s signature Precisionist approach—sharp geometric forms and vibrant, expressive colors—while capturing the tension between industrialization and natural serenity. The composition balances smokestacks and angular rooftops against softer skies, reflecting his fascination with structural abstraction and emotional resonance. Deeply influenced by avant-garde movements like German Expressionism and Cubism, Bluemner’s vision merges European modernism with American subject matter, securing his place as a pivotal yet underrated figure in early modern American art. The painting’s dramatic contrasts of burnt oranges, deep blues, and shadowy blacks evoke both the dynamism and melancholy of the machine age, inviting viewers to contemplate progress’s duality.
